XRP withdrawals from Binance rise 53% while deposits drop 46%

  • On April 15, the ratio of XRP withdrawals to deposits on the Binance crypto exchange reached levels last seen in June 2025.
  • Withdrawals increased by 53%, while deposits decreased by 46%.
  • This pattern indicates reduced pressure from both sellers and buyers.

Currently, XRP is showing signs of weakening selling pressure on exchanges. A chart published by CryptoQuant analyst Amr Taha shows withdrawals rising to 53% of the 7-day average, while deposits dropped to 46%.

The increase in withdrawals and decline in deposits does not necessarily signal immediate price growth, but it does point to some stabilization in the XRP market. The outflow of tokens from exchanges suggests that fewer holders are preparing to sell in the near term.

Amid the continued decline in XRP’s price — which reached $1.35 on April 15 after a 1.4% daily drop — users are likely opting to store their assets in non-custodial wallets, which are considered less risky than exchange-based custodial solutions.

The CryptoQuant chart tracks the relationship between XRP price and the percentage of deposit and withdrawal operations on Binance over the past year.

In the near term, without clear catalysts for growth, XRP’s price is likely to follow Bitcoin and the broader crypto market. However, comparing the declines from January 2026 peaks ($95,000 for BTC and $2.4 for XRP), losses stand at approximately 20% and 45%, respectively — indicating a significantly deeper drawdown for XRP.

Currently, Bitcoin is trading around $74,000, having lost nearly $2,000 gained on April 14. Meanwhile, Bitcoin dominance remains high at 57.3%, suggesting that current crypto market fluctuations are largely driven by capital inflows and outflows in the leading cryptocurrency.

Number of XRP Tokens on Binance Falls to a Three-Month Low

The $XRP reserve on Binance, the world’s largest cryptocurrency exchange by trading volume, fell to 2.7 billion tokens on June 7, compared with 2.77 billion $XRP on March 5, 2026. As a result, the supply of $XRP on Binance decreased by 66.05 million, reflecting a 2.38% decline over the period, according to CryptoQuant data analysed by Happy Coin News on June 8.

XRP Investors Are Withdrawing Massive Amounts of Coins From Binance!

Analytics platform CryptoQuant reported that large XRP investors have recently been actively withdrawing their assets from Binance. According to the data, approximately 403 million XRP have been withdrawn from Binance since May 3. It was noted that most of these transactions involved 1 million XRP or more, indicating that the data primarily reflects the behavior of large players and institutional investors.

Liquidity of XRP on Binance Drops to Record Lows

Liquidity of $XRP on Binance has dropped to its lowest levels in recent years — this could become one of the key factors for price instability in the near future. According to analysts, the 30-day liquidity index for $XRP has decreased to approximately 0.062, one of the lowest levels in a long period. At the same time, the turnover dropped to $4.46 billion, indicating a noticeable decline in trading activity.
